On 08/01/2018 05:25 AM, Marc Glisse wrote:
Throwing new is returns_nonnull (errors are reported with exceptions) so
that's fine, but non-throwing new is not:
int* p1 = new(std::nothrow) int;
Here errors are reported by returning 0, so it is common to test if p1
is 0 and this is precisely the
